Bottom Line

The Rapala Countdown is the hard bait I reach for most on still water — count it down to the depth trout are holding and fish it from shore or kayak with confidence. The Rebel Tracdown Minnow is a strong second pick when you want a smaller slow-sinking crankbait and a stop-and-go retrieve at a lower price point.
